Abstract

fetched live from OpenAlex

Regional and spatial studies, such as urban planning, energy planning, and sustainable development, address the complexity of the inter-disciplinary relationship between subsystems and their components. Such studies require multidisciplinary concepts, varied lenses, and differentiating approaches and models to address the conflict between contextual sensitivity and universal applicability. This paper reviews the debate on the research approaches adopted in regional studies and initiated by researcher Ann Markusen, followed by a review of contemporary literature on the concept of fuzziness in the qualitative research. Markusen evaluated the conceptual fuzziness, empirical evidence, and policy dimensions of regional studies. The argument was based on three fundamental aspects of regional and urban development studies; strong contestation of phenomena, empirical evidence to support the concept, and collective action to deal with the problems under investigation. A conceptual fuzziness and the methodological weaknesses in the qualitative research, highlighted by Markusen almost two decades ago, persist in interdisciplinary qualitative research. In this study, we have dissected the concept of fuzziness to distinguish between Inherited fuzziness derived from the configurational complexity of a case and bequeathed fuzziness that could be transferred ahead due to a researcher’s methodological and perceptual weaknesses. Despite efforts made to address the relevance, reliability, validity, and replicability of the qualitative research, the field is still facing challenges from conceptual bias, methodological and operational constraints, empirical weakness, and prejudiced interpretation.
